Kinds Of Bass Lures and Their Makes use of
A variety of bass Lures are crucial tools for anglers intending to attract this popular video game fish. These Lures can be classified into numerous kinds, each serving distinctive objectives. Crankbaits, created to simulate the swimming action of baitfish, work for covering huge areas rapidly. Spinnerbaits, featuring turning blades, develop resonances and flashes that can attract bass hiding in cover. Jigs, with their hefty heads and weedless style, are ideal for bottom angling, allowing anglers to present bait near frameworks where bass frequently lurk. Soft plastics, such as worms and creature lures, supply convenience and can be rigged in several means to adjust to varying problems. Topwater appeals, like poppers and frogs, are best employed during low-light hours when bass are proactively preying on the surface area. Each sort of attraction plays an essential function in improving angling experiences and raising the likelihood of effective catches.
Design and color: What Attracts Bass?
What aspects influence bass destination to certain lure design and colors? The interplay of light, water quality, and the natural atmosphere plays an important role. Brilliant colors, such as chartreuse and orange, can catch a bass's eye in dirty waters, while more subdued tones like blues and eco-friendlies may excel in clear problems.Style elements, consisting of shape and activity, likewise considerably influence bass tourist attraction. Lures that mimic all-natural prey, such as baitfish or crawfish, are specifically efficient. Additionally, the visibility of reasonable information, like scales or fins, boosts the realistic look, more luring bass.
Psychological factors, such as a bass's feeding behaviors and territorial impulses, need to not be overlooked. In specific circumstances, strong designs can prompt a reaction from aggressive bass, while refined variations can appeal to extra careful fish. Inevitably, recognizing color and style subtleties is vital for optimizing attraction performance.
Matching Lures to Water Issues
Choosing the right attraction entails even more than simply design and color; water conditions play a substantial duty in figuring out one of the most effective alternatives. Variables such as water quality, depth, and temperature level straight affect bass actions and their feeding patterns. In clear water, natural shades and subtle discussions often tend to be much more effective, while dirty problems may ask for brighter, a lot more vibrant Lures that can draw in interest.Temperature additionally impacts bass activity; throughout warmer months, faster-moving Lures can evoke strikes, whereas cooler temperature levels may call for slower, more deliberate discussions. Furthermore, much deeper waters commonly demand larger Lures that can reach the desired deepness, while superficial locations are much better matched for lighter, surface-oriented options.
